English Translation

Qatada (may Allah be pleased with him) reported that we used to visit Anas bin Malik while his baker was standing (and baking). Anas would say, "Eat! I do not know that the Prophet ﷺ had ever seen well-baked bread till he met Allah, nor had he ever seen a roasted sheep with his own eyes

Reference: Sahih al-Bukhari, Food, Meals, Hadith 49
